Patra - Meghnagar, Jhabua

Patra is a village situated in the Meghnagar tehsil of Jhabua district, Madhya Pradesh. It is located approximately 22 km from the tehsil headquarters in Meghnagar and around 38 km from the district headquarters in Jhabua. Patra village is a designated Gram Panchayat.

As per Census 2011, the village code of Patra is 504457. The village covers a total geographical area of 296.68 hectares and falls under the 457779 pincode. Dahod is the nearest town, located about 20 km away.

Patra village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head.

Population of Patra

As per Census 2011, Patra village has a total population of 1,505 people, consisting of 764 males and 741 females. The village has 238 households and a sex ratio of 969 females per 1,000 males. There are 378 children in the 0–6 years age group. The village has 286 literate and 1,219 illiterate residents. Additionally, 3 people belong to Scheduled Caste (SC) communities and 1,494 to Scheduled Tribe (ST) communities.

Transport and Connectivity of Patra

Patra is connected by an all-weather road, and public transport is mainly available through bus services. The nearest railway station is Anas, while the nearest airport is Vadodara Airport, situated at an approximate aerial distance of 110.6 km.

The road distance from Dahod to Patra is about 20 km, with a usual travel time of around 30-60 minutes. Similarly, the road distance from Jhabua to Patra is about 38 km, with the usual travel time around 1-1.25 hours. Actual travel time may vary depending on road conditions and mode of transport.
